The water level is stable at four of the 109 points of the country’s rivers and is flowing over the danger line at 19 points. Water decreased by 29 points. The Flood Forecasting and Warning Center said on Monday.

Meanwhile, the weather forecast said that due to the effect of active monsoon winds, rains may continue in most parts of eight divisions of the country even on Tuesday.
Besides, there may be heavy rain in five sections including Sylhet.
According to the flood forecasting and warning center, the water level in various rivers of the country has risen at 6 points and decreased at 29 points. According to a bulletin issued yesterday, the water level in four of the 109 points of the river is stable and the water level in 19 points is flowing above the danger level.

According to the Meteorological Department forecast for the next 24 hours yesterday evening, monsoon winds are active over Bangladesh and moderate conditions are prevailing in the North Bay. Meteorologist Muhammad Abul Kalam Mallick told Kaler Kanth: “Most parts of Rangpur, Rajshahi, Dhaka, Mymensingh, Khulna, Barisal, Chittagong and Sylhet divisions may experience light to moderate rain or thundershowers on Tuesday. There may be moderate to very heavy rainfall in Rangpur, Mymensingh, Barisal, Chittagong and Sylhet divisions. “The rains are likely to continue till next Thursday,” he said.
